Opinion Outpost is a paid survey site that helps connect survey takers to studies conducted by some of the world's biggest companies. By taking surveys, you can make quick cash from home while helping your favorite brands adapt and grow.

The website is owned by Dynata which is a global sampling and survey company. A pioneer in the world of online market research, Opinion Outpost has been around for more than a decade!

How Opinion Outpost Works

opinion outpost website

Share Your Opinions to Earn Rewards

Opinion Outpost gives everyday consumers the opportunities to participate in online surveys and product tests in exchange for cash rewards and gift cards.

Signing up is free and to do so, simply enter your name, date of birth, zip code and email address on the registration form on their website. After that, you’ll be prompted to confirm your email address before you’re able to begin answering surveys.

Take Surveys and More

Once you've fully registered, you’ll see a “Surveys” link on your main account dashboard. This will take you to your list of available surveys. You can choose to have surveys emailed to you if you prefer.

You also have the option to add additional information (via profile surveys) to help Opinion Outpost match you with more relevant surveys to you.

Payment and Rewards

opinion outpost rewards

Earn Great Rewards for Participating

Sign up with Opinion Outpost to take paid surveys and complete product testing assignments in exchange for rewards. Simply join the site for free and receive invitations to complete online surveys on your computer or mobile device.

You don't have to wait long to get rewarded - if you take a survey worth 50 points, you'll already have enough to redeem a $5 Amazon.com gift card. The following reward options are offered on the site in exchange for participating:

  • PayPal payments - with only 100 points (worth $10/£5), you can request that a PayPal payment be made to your account. Bear in mind that only verified PayPal accounts will qualify for payment.
  • Amazon e-vouchers - with just 50 points ($5) in your account, you can request an Amazon.com e-gift code.
  • Apple Store gift cards - with 100 points ($10) sitting in your account, you can request an app store / iTunes gift card.
  • Retail gift cards - with 100 points ($10) in your account, you can receive a gift card to Nike, Domino’s Pizza, The Home Depot, CVS, Chili’s 3-Choice and more.
  • Visa prepaid cards - with 100 points ($10) in your account, you can purchase a virtual Visa prepaid card to spend online or add to your smartphone app for offline spending.
Points Value: 1 Opinion Outpost point = $0.10. Therefore, 10 points = $1.00

Note that rewards will vary slightly by country. For example, Air Miles Reward Miles are available to Canadian members only (receive 50 Air Miles for 100 Opinion Outpost points).

Super-Fast Rewards Delivery

Opinion Outpost is very unique in that rewards are often delivered instantly after requesting them. It's uncommon to have to wait more than a few minutes/hours to receive a PayPal payment or e-gift card that you've requested, though technically they advertise a 3 day rewards processing period.

Survey Taking Experience

opinion outpost survey

Take Surveys Often

Paid surveys will be sent to you on a regular basis. You can also visit the website, log in and find a list of available surveys, giving you plenty of chances to make cash. A typical Opinion Outpost survey takes 10-15 minutes to complete and the number of points you can expect to receive per survey ranges between 5 to 50 points.

Qualifying Questions

Before you begin your chosen survey, you may have to answer a series of multiple-choice questions. These may appear to be irrelevant to the topic of the survey itself, but are a way for researchers to ensure they're receiving responses from the people they're looking for answers from. Sometimes, you’ll be disqualified from taking the survey after answering these, however there will usually be other surveys available for you to take.

Modern, Interactive Surveys

Opinion Outpost offers fun, interactive online surveys that are attractive and simple to take. On top of offering sweepstakes entries, periodically, they offer games at the end of surveys which give you the opportunity to win additional points and/or additional sweepstakes entries. One such game is called the Opinion Outpost Door Game.

Opinion Outpost App

Opinion Outpost does not offer a mobile app. Although most of their surveys are mobile-friendly and can be completed on your phone, you will still need to access them via your e-mail, or by logging into the website from your phone.

Community Features

opinion outpost badges

Badges

Opinion Output offers ‘Badges’, which essentially serve as loyalty bonuses. You will start out with a Bronze membership and have the chance to upgrade to Silver, Gold, Platinum or Diamond based on how active you are on the website and how complete your profile is.

As your badge levels increase, additional achievement points are awarded, which can be found on your Survey History page. These will show up as 'community achievement'. Bear in mind that you can be downgraded to a lower tier badge if you don’t remain active on the website.

Quarterly Chances to Win $10,000

If you are in the USA and you get disqualified from a survey, participate in a survey, or exchange your valuable points for an entry, you will have a chance to win $10,000 in a quarterly cash draw. That means that $40,000 in total is awarded to 4 lucky members every year! If you are in Canada, there are also sweepstakes available in the form of 4 quarterly draws worth $1,250 each ($5,000 yearly).

Refer Your Friends to Earn More

Opinion Outpost's referral program will award you $1.00 every time you refer a friend using your custom link and they complete at least one survey. Earn up to $5.00 in total. Find the "refer a friend" tab when you log into your account to grab your custom referral link to share with friends or extended family members (available to US panelists only).

Is Opinion Outpost Legit or Scam?

opinion outpost legit

Is Opinion Outpost Legit?

Opinion Outpost is over a decade old and is a legitimate survey site that pays approximately $5 million dollars in rewards to its members every year. Opinion Outpost is not a scam, though as with any survey program, your experience and success with the site may vary. The site does not sell information to third parties (as per their commitment to adhering to market research standards), and is a safe and legit website.

Before joining any survey site, it is advisable to consult user reviews, so that you can get a sense of other people's experiences. Scroll down to read hundreds of Opinion Outpost reviews.

Eligibility: Opinion Outpost is open to USA residents who are 17+, UK residents who are 16+, residents of Canada who are 19+ as well as residents of Germany, Spain, France, and Italy.
